The **FK14C0G2A Series** is a premium line of high-performance, surface-mount ceramic capacitors designed for applications requiring exceptional stability, precision, and reliability. These capacitors are constructed using **Class I C0G (NP0) dielectric material**, which provides ultra-stable capacitance characteristics across a wide temperature range of **-55°C to +125°C**. With a capacitance tolerance as tight as **±0.1pF**, the FK14C0G2A Series is ideal for circuits where precision is paramount, such as in RF, microwave, and timing applications.

One of the standout features of the FK14C0G2A Series is its **low equivalent series resistance (ESR)** and **low dissipation factor (DF)**, which ensure minimal energy loss and high efficiency in high-frequency applications. This makes the series particularly suitable for use in **RF matching networks**, **oscillators**, **filters**, and **resonant circuits**. Additionally, the capacitors exhibit **excellent thermal stability**, with virtually no change in capacitance over temperature, making them a reliable choice for environments with fluctuating thermal conditions.
